What Happened In Just One Night?
US and Israel launched coordinated strikes on Iran so devastating, so precise, that the world is still trying to process it. In less than 24 hours — Khamenei’s compound was destroyed, the IRGC commander was killed, the Defence Minister was taken out, and according to CBS News intelligence sources, approximately 40 Iranian officials were eliminated in the strikes.
Khamenei’s own daughter, son-in-law, and grandchild were also killed in the attacks.

So Why Is Iran Still Silent?
Here’s the part nobody is talking about. Iranian officials have still not officially confirmed Khamenei’s death. State television told citizens to ignore what they called “the enemy’s psychological propaganda.” But when Trump personally announces it on social media, when Netanyahu calls him “gone” in a live address, and when people are dancing in the streets of Tehran — that silence speaks louder than any confirmation ever could.
Verified videos from Karaj and Tehran show Iranians celebrating in the streets, honking horns, cheering from apartment windows. One man screamed into the camera: “I’m dreaming — hello new world!”
What Does Trump Want Next?
Trump made it crystal clear — bombing continues throughout the week. He’s already offering IRGC and police forces full immunity if they stand down and join what he’s calling “Iranian patriots.” He’s even hinted he already has “good candidates” in mind for Iran’s new leadership.
